How to Find a Great DJ

by Kelly Suit

KC Enterprises Disc Jockey and Photography

   You've gotten the ring, the dress, and reserved your ceremony location.  You've selected the reception site and discussed your menu with your caterer.  You may have made other decisions by now as well (flowers, cake, photographer, etc.), but you have come to the point were you need to choose the Disc Jockey.  This is a very important decision when you take in to account that no other vendor has as much opportunity to make or break your reception.  The question you are asking yourself now is how do I find the entertainer that that best suits my needs and I can trust to do a great job.  

    There are many ways to find the right DJ for you.  One of the best ways is to go with a DJ that you have already seen and liked.  Nothing is better then having first hand knowledge of exactly what you are getting with your entertainer.  If you haven't seen any DJ's that seemed right for you, ask you friends, family, and co-workers for recommendations.  Chances are that someone has had or seen a DJ that left a good impression.  On the chance that no one can produce a referral, try asking some of the other vendors that you have hired for a recommendation.   Using a search engine or the yellow pages to get more choices is also available, but remember that not all DJ's are alike and if you haven't received their name through referral be cautious before making a decision.  I strongly suggest talking to two or three entertainers before making your final decision.

    After you select a few DJ's that seem promising, make an appointment to meet them in person.  This is very important because you need to get a feel if this person is a good match for your personality.  Your DJ should be friendly and enthusiastic about your wedding.  They should be able to offer suggestions on what they can do to help make your reception unique and enjoyable.  Your DJ is going to be responsible for the success or failure of your reception, so make sure that you feel this person handles them self in a professional manner, shows up on time for your meeting, and gives you a sense of peace about your decision.

    Make sure that your DJ provides you a copy of the contract and that it is specified that they will be the DJ that does your reception from start to finish.  Be concerned if your disc jockey won't put this in writing.  You don't want to get a different Disc Jockey at your wedding or have your entertainer leave in the middle of the reception and have another DJ finish.  Ask your DJ the 10 questions  that we have provided.  

    Finally don't let price be the most important consideration when choosing your entertainment.  There is a reason why the cheapest DJ is the cheapest.  You usually get what you pay for and while the highest price doesn't guarantee the best entertainment, talent and quality do cost more.  No price is a good price if you don't get what you pay for.  This is a once in a lifetime occasion, let your heart be the determining factor and not your wallet.  Congratulations and Best Wishes!
